I know it doesn't seem right to be scouring the interwebs for "cheap" chandeliers, but, you know, times are tough. And in such times, one still may have wish for a lovely chandelier to brighten a room in their home. I personally have deep wish for such things in my dining room (also love them over a tub).
So here is the chandelier roundup: four pretty and affordable chandeliers that won't break the bank—all under $90 and most under $50.
(Clockwise from top left): 1) Tear Drop Chandelier from Urban Outfitters, $48, 2) Kristaller Chandelier from IKEA, $39.99, 3) Teardrop Chandelier at dELiA's, $49, and 4) Mini Chandelier from Target, $89.99.
